'Chintz Applique: From Imitation to Icon' Opens at Quilt Museum
A new exhibition at the International Quilt Study Center and Museum at the University of Nebraska-Lincoln traces connections of textile fashion, technology and trade in "Chintz Applique: From Imitation to Icon." Organized by Carolyn Ducey, curator of collections, the exhibition will be on view Nov. 22 through May 17 at the museum, 1523 N. 33rd St.
Inspired by the painted and printed cottons of India, famous for their lively beauty and lasting qualities, the stunning colors and artistry of chintz applique quilts made them icons in the 19th century. They are considered among the most beautifully crafted, vibrantly colored and largest quilts ever made in America.
